## Changelog — Ticktrace 1.9

### Renamed: DRIFT_API_TOKEN
During the cron drift investigation we found plugins confusing this variable with the metrics token, so it has been renamed to indicate it authorizes drift-report uploads specifically. Plugin authors must read the new name from 1.9 onward; the old name is ignored without warning. Sample env files in the SDK are updated. In your deployment env file, the drift-report upload secret is set on the next line.

env line for fawef-taguf: VAULT_KEY13=a9695905a9a90

Subject: Shrinkray CLI cut-over complete

Hi all — the cut-over from the legacy resize scripts to the Shrinkray CLI finished last night. All batch jobs now route through the new worker pool, and the old scripts are archived read-only. New team members should install the CLI from the internal registry before picking up any image tickets. Your local install needs the following configuration values.

deployment values, faduf-tawep:
SORDOR_LOG_LEVEL=error
SORDOR_METRICS_HOST=metrics.sordor.nelvrolabs.internal
SORDOR_POOL_SIZE=4

## Account Recovery — Parityline SDK Program

Context: the Parityline program tracks feature parity between the Kestrel and Marlin client SDKs. The release dashboard account occasionally locks after failed token refreshes, blocking parity sign-off. Recovery: suspend the sync job, trigger the recovery flow from the admin console, and re-enable sync once parity checks pass. Do not cut a release while the account is locked. The recovery passphrase for the dashboard account is below.

unlock words, kagef-taduf: fenir-quenix-norwyn-sorvan-gormir-gorir-fraok

## Compressing telemetry payloads

The Opaline collector compresses all telemetry batches before shipping them to the Marrowgate ingest tier. New team members: compression runs automatically, but if ingest reports oversized payloads, check that the agent config has batching enabled and the window is under 30 seconds. Never disable compression in production — the ingest tier rejects raw payloads over 2 MB. If you need to reproduce an issue locally, use the reference agent build, whose identifier appears below.

build token for kagaf-hahof: htk14_9d3d4d26d7d8de